TPWallet究竟算不算热钱包?从防时序攻击到实时资产监控的全方位解析

以下讨论中的“TPWallet”指的是常见的移动端/网页端数字资产钱包形态(用于快速发起链上交互与转账)。在区块链安全语境里,它通常属于“热钱包”的范畴:

一、TPWallet是热钱包还是冷钱包?

1)直观定义

- 热钱包:密钥/签名能力在联网环境可达(通常在手机或浏览器内),更利于频繁使用与快捷交易。

- 冷钱包:密钥离线保存、签名流程尽量在断网环境完成,更适合长期大额持有。

2)从使用方式推断

- 若钱包主要用于日常转账、DApp交互、Swap/跨链等需要快速响应的场景,且用户常规操作都发生在联网设备上、签名由钱包端完成,则通常被归类为热钱包。

- 若提供离线签名或将私钥完全隔离在离线设备、并以签名结果回传,则可接近“冷钱包思路”。

结论(面向多数产品形态的通用判断):

- 在大多数主流形态下,TPWallet更接近“热钱包”。即便它可能引入多重签名、风险控制或链上验证,但“联网可用、随时交互”的属性决定了它属于热钱包风险模型。

二、热钱包的核心风险图谱

热钱包面对的主要挑战不是“能不能签名”,而是“如何在联网环境下降低攻击面”,包括:

- 时序与操作暴露:攻击者通过观察请求/响应时间、调用顺序、Gas分布推断用户行为。

- 合约层风险:路由、权限、授权、价格/路由操纵、重入/回调等。

- 欺诈与社会工程:钓鱼DApp、假授权、恶意合约、错误网络/错误合约地址。

- 资产监控不足:风险交易未被及时识别,或无法在异常前预警。

- 实时性与误报:监控系统过慢会失去意义,过多误报又会拖慢用户决策。

三、防时序攻击(Time-based Attacks)

防时序攻击的目标是:让外部观察者难以从“时间相关特征”推断用户意图或策略。

1)威胁来源

- 区块链与RPC交互天然可观测:交易发送时间、批量提交的间隔、签名请求触发时刻等都可能形成可识别模式。

- 代理/中间服务的日志、浏览器/移动端网络栈行为,也会引入指纹。

2)可行技术手段(钱包侧与链侧组合)

- 交易节流与随机化延迟:对同类操作引入小幅随机等待,打散可预测节奏(注意不要引发超时导致失败)。

- 批处理与统一交互路径:尽量减少“唯一的一次性操作特征”,例如在同一流程里统一编码、统一路由模板。

- 本地缓存与预取:将必要的数据提前准备,减少“签名触发后才请求关键参数”的时间峰值。

- 隐藏/均衡可观测字段:在链上提交前对参数结构保持稳定的编码逻辑,减少结构差异导致的识别。

- 尽量避免泄漏敏感元数据:如错误重试策略、失败回退路径的可观测分支。

四、合约优化(Smart Contract Optimization)

热钱包常与合约交互,因此“合约优化”至少覆盖三条线:安全、可预测、可审计。

1)安全性优化

- 权限最小化:避免过度的owner权限、降低管理员密钥被滥用风险。

- 代币交互防御:对ERC20/ERC777等差异处理要谨慎,减少“标准不一致导致的逻辑绕过”。

- 重入防护:对外部调用使用checks-effects-interactions模式,关键函数加重入保护。

- 授权撤销与限制:合约与路由应鼓励或支持有限额度授权、以及更易撤销的授权结构。

2)性能与经济性优化

- Gas优化:减少不必要的存储写入与复杂循环。

- 路由路径优化:在多跳交易中优先考虑更稳健的路径选择(在保证最小滑点与最小失败率的前提下)。

3)可审计性优化

- 统一事件日志:让监控系统能更精准地识别“异常授权”“异常代币转出”“失败的回滚原因”等。

- 明确失败码/错误消息:便于钱包端快速分类风险并提示用户。

五、专业研判展望(研判框架)

为了做“专业研判”,不能只谈功能点,还要建立可验证的评估框架:

1)威胁建模(Threat Modeling)

- 攻击者能力:能否控制网络?能否诱导用户签名?能否部署钓鱼合约?

- 目标资产:USDT/ETH类主流资产 vs 小币种;是否涉及无限授权。

- 攻击面:钱包签名、DApp注入、交易路由、跨链桥、授权与撤销。

2)验证指标(可度量)

- 授权安全:无限授权拦截率、撤销推荐成功率。

- 交易识别:风险交易拦截/提示的准确率、响应延迟。

- 抗操纵能力:价格路由异常检测、滑点阈值保护。

- 时序抗性:交易节奏随机化策略的有效性(以“可预测性下降”为目标)。

3)未来可能的方向

- 从“事后提示”走向“事前阻断”:对高风险合约/高风险授权更早拦截。

- 风险自适应策略:根据网络拥堵、历史行为、合约信誉评分动态调整。

六、全球化技术趋势(Global Tech Trends)

1)多链多环境标准化

- 钱包需要面对不同链的签名流程、手续费机制、合约兼容性差异。

- 未来更强趋势是:在不同链上维持一致的安全策略(授权检查、风险提示、交易仿真)。

2)隐私与可观测平衡

- 监管与合规、审计需求增强,同时用户隐私保护也在推进。

- 因此“可审计但不泄漏敏感决策”的设计会越来越重要。

3)智能化风控(AI辅助)

- 使用行为特征、合约交互模式、交易结构异常来辅助判断欺诈。

- 关键在于:可解释性与低误报率,否则会影响用户体验。

4)跨组织安全生态

- 钱包、DApp、交易所、链上监控共同形成安全闭环:共享恶意合约情报、地址黑名单/灰名单、事件指纹。

七、实时资产监控(Real-time Asset Monitoring)

实时监控要解决的不是“能显示余额”,而是“能在风险发生前后第一时间识别异常”。

1)监控对象

- 资产余额与代币转出/转入

- 授权事件(Approval/Permit等)

- 关键合约交互(DEX路由、跨链合约、代理合约)

- 异常Gas支出与失败原因聚类

2)监控机制

- 本地实时订阅 + 链上事件回放:确保在不同网络延迟下仍能追踪。

- 交易前仿真(Simulate):在签名前先跑一遍“可能结果”,再决定给出提示或直接拒绝。

- 阈值与规则引擎:例如“单次滑点超过阈值”“授权额度大于历史常用额度”“新合约首次交互且无信誉标签”等。

3)用户体验原则

- 风险解释要可读:告诉用户“为什么风险”,而不是只给“危险”。

- 支持一键撤销/一键跳转到风险操作的关键信息。

八、防欺诈技术(Anti-fraud Techniques)

热钱包在防欺诈上,常见策略可分为“交易级、合约级、交互级、社会工程级”。

1)合约级防护

- 合约黑白名单与信誉评分:识别已知恶意合约、可疑代理合约。

- ABI/字节码一致性校验:避免用相似名称/相似UI引导用户签名不相关的合约。

2)交易级防护

- 授权安全:

- 拦截无限授权或提示“授权将导致资产可被转走”。

- 强制展示授权范围、授权对象与到期策略。

- 交易仿真与结果对齐:

- 若仿真结果显示“预期代币流入不一致/净损失过大”,提高拦截等级。

3)交互级防护

- 防钓鱼DApp:

- 域名/合约/路由的可信来源验证。

- 降低“假网站注入交易”的成功率。

- 网络识别与链匹配:

- 提示用户网络切换风险,防止把资产签在错误链。

4)社会工程防护

- 对高风险操作的二次确认:例如大额转账、授权额度显著变化、首次交互未知合约。

- 风险教育内嵌:将常见诈骗套路(假客服、假空投、授权骗局)以情境化方式展示。

九、综合结论

- 以典型产品形态来看,TPWallet更符合“热钱包”模型:高便利与高可用性意味着更需要完善的安全对冲手段。

- 在安全能力上,防时序攻击、合约优化、实时资产监控与防欺诈技术构成闭环:

- 前者降低外部推断与操作暴露;

- 后者提升交互合约的安全与可预测性;

- 再者通过实时监控把异常“尽早暴露”;

- 最后用欺诈检测与交易仿真把“风险交易”尽量阻断在签名前。

- 展望未来,多链化、全球化标准、智能化风控与可解释的安全策略将是热钱包走向更成熟的关键路径。

注:以上为安全与产品形态的通用解析框架。不同版本的TPWallet在具体实现(如是否支持离线签名、多签/托管细节、风控策略阈值)可能不同;如你希望更精确判断,可以补充你使用的具体平台/版本与核心功能(例如是否提供离线签名或私钥隔离方式)。

作者:清风链上编辑发布时间:2026-06-13 12:18:59

评论

MiaChen

把热钱包的风险点讲得很系统:时序、合约、欺诈、监控一条线串起来,读完知道该看什么指标了。

LeoWang

文里“仿真结果对齐”和“授权安全”这两段很实用,尤其是无限授权的提醒思路。

Sora

喜欢你对全球化技术趋势的总结,尤其多链一致风控那部分,感觉未来差距会拉开在工程化能力上。

HarperZhang

实时资产监控的目标不是余额而是异常识别,这个定位对用户很关键。

Nova

防时序攻击写得有方向:随机化延迟、节流、统一交互路径这些点都落地。

相关阅读